Day 3 - Capoeira class

Capoeira is a combination of martial arts, sport and popular culture developed in Brazil by African slaves and Brazilian natives. In Brazil, Capoeira style was developed by Mestre Bimba, founder of the first Academy of Brazilian Capoeira. In this class, your family will have the opportunity to know the basic principles of capoeira and its movements, whilst being taught by a disciple of Mestre Bimba.

Day 6 - Half day Sugarloaf and cooking class

Every year, over a million visitors go to the famous Pão de Açúcar (Sugarloaf Mountain), an iconic symbol of the city of Rio de Janeiro. Its name was given due to the resemblance to the traditional shape of a refined sugar loaf. Today your family will follow in these footsteps as you will travel by cable car to the top of Urca Hill first and then to Sugarloaf, rising 395 metres above sea level and offering a 360 degrees view of the entire city. Day 9 - Tour of the Brazilian side of the falls and Bird Park

Today will be a day of visual delights! You will visit the Brazilian side of the falls which offers a more panoramic view of the natural wonder and will give you a better idea of how big and majestic they are! Afterwards you will visit the Birds Park which is located next to the entrance of Iguaçu National Park. It is one of the most known attractions of the region, as it is the home of birds from all over the world. Set in beautiful surroundings, you will have direct contact with more than 150 species of birds in 16.5 hectares of spectacular Atlantic Forest. You will be side by side with toucans, scarlet ibises, macaws, jays and more!

The North Pantanal
The Pantanal is the world's largest wetland and Brazil's best place to get close and personal to an immense array of flora and fauna, including the jaguar. If you are a nature lover, this is the place you want to be at least once in your life!
The South Pantanal
The southern part of the Pantanal is less visited than the northern counterpart but it offers the same opportunities to get in close contact with nature. If you want to see the anteater, head here for you chance to see this wonderful mammal.
